The Canon XA75 Professional Camcorder is tailored for those looking to capture high-quality videos for professional purposes. The camcorder's 1-inch CMOS sensor and DIGIC DV6 processor work together to deliver stunning 4K UHD and Full HD imagery, ensuring vibrant colors and clear details. Its 15x optical zoom lens allows for versatile shooting, from wide-angle shots to distant subjects, making it quite flexible in various shooting scenarios. Additionally, it supports multiple recording formats (XF-AVC and MP4), providing flexibility for different project needs and simultaneous recording with dual SD card slots to ensure you don't miss any crucial moments.
For audio, the camcorder offers professional-grade control with 2 XLR terminals and 4-channel linear PCM, ensuring clear and high-quality sound capture. Connectivity options are robust, with mini-HDMI, 3G-SDI, USB Type-C, and UVC support for effortless video sharing and live streaming. The 3.5-inch touchscreen LCD and OLED EVF make navigation and focusing user-friendly. However, the maximum aperture of 4.5 f might be a limitation in low-light conditions compared to other cams with wider apertures. The audio capabilities, while professional, might require additional equipment like external microphones to maximize their potential.
The Canon XA75 is a strong contender for professionals needing a reliable, high-quality camcorder with versatile connectivity and solid image stabilization for steady footage.
The Canon XA60 Professional UHD 4K Camcorder is a compact and powerful device designed for professional video capture. It boasts a 1/2.3" CMOS sensor and DIGIC DV6 processor, ensuring excellent image quality in 4K UHD and Full HD resolutions. With a 20x optical zoom lens, it's suitable for capturing a range of scenes from wide angles to distant subjects. This camcorder supports multiple recording formats, including XF-AVC and MP4, providing flexibility in various shooting environments.
It enables high-definition live streaming via USB Type-C output, making it ideal for real-time broadcasting. The dual SD card slots allow for simultaneous and relay recording, ensuring you won't miss any critical moments. Audio capabilities are robust, with 2 XLR terminals for professional sound control, complemented by 4-channel linear PCM for clarity. Stabilization features include infrared and optical stabilization, which helps produce steady footage even in challenging conditions.
The 3.5" touchscreen LCD and tiltable OLED EVF offer intuitive controls and excellent viewing options. Connectivity is well-covered with mini-HDMI and USB ports, allowing easy integration with external devices. However, the maximum aperture of 2.8 f might limit low-light performance, and while the camcorder is lightweight at 1.63 pounds, it may require additional accessories for extended shoots, which could impact its portability. The Canon XA60's battery life is sufficient but will need monitoring during prolonged use. It’s ideal for professional videographers needing a reliable and versatile camcorder for various projects.
The Sony PXW-Z90V is a compact professional video camcorder that boasts a 1-inch type CMOS sensor, delivering high-quality 4K video capture. With a maximum aperture of f/2 and a focal length of 32.8 millimeters, the lens quality is commendable, suitable for various shooting conditions. It supports a variety of audio formats including MPEG-4 AAC and MPEG-2 AAC, ensuring good audio capabilities for professional use.
The camcorder features Fast Hybrid Auto Focus with advanced functionalities and an Instant HDR workflow with HLG, making it effective for dynamic shooting and rapid post-production work. Additionally, the Super Slow Motion and S&Q Motion in Full HD XAVC 10-bit 4:2:2 offer excellent flexibility for creative projects. The Wi-Fi connectivity and support for the XDCAM Air production system enhance its networking capabilities, making live streaming and remote production seamless.
Its battery life is supported by a single lithium-ion battery, which is reasonable but may require extra batteries for extended shoots. One downside might be its weight (2.4 pounds) and dimensions (5.13 x 7.25 x 11.38 inches), which could be cumbersome for handheld use over long periods. The Sony PXW-Z90V is an excellent choice for professionals needing a reliable, high-quality camcorder with advanced features, though its portability might be a slight drawback.
